About The Position

Reviews sediment and erosion control, stormwater, water quality plans, and stormwater calculations/engineer reports. Reviews plans, elevation certificates, flood studies, and other regulatory submittals for floodplain encroachment and/or compliance with the County's Flood Damage Prevention ordinance. Reviews residential and commercial building permits for stormwater compliance. Review plans for roadway, utility infrastructure, and associated land disturbance impacts to waterbodies. Review retaining wall plans for scour and erosion impact and sustainability. Review and assess detention waiver requests. Reviews stormwater and roadway as-builts. Assist in review and processing of bond requests for off-site sedimentation and final stabilization. Performs site visits and/or inspections for floodplain and stormwater compliance, as needed, which requires the ability to drive and operate a vehicle. Coordinate with other local, State and Federal government agencies on permit application approvals. Maintain Stormwater Compliance permit databases, archived files, and GIS data. Issues County Land Disturbance Permits for County and State approved plans. Coordinate and provide support to Environmental Compliance Inspectors on specific project issues, including approved and stamped plan sets, Pre-Construction Conferences, compliance and potential violation questions, bonding requests, as-built inspections, and Notices of Termination applications.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ree
  • Two (2) years of experience in permitting, engineering, planning, or related field.
  • Valid state driver’s license.
  • Must possess or obtain within one year of hire: Certified Stormwater Plan Reviewer (CSPR).
  • Must possess or obtain within two years of hire: Certified Floodplain Manager (CFM).

Nice To Haves

  • Certified Erosion Prevention and Sediment Control Inspector (CEPSCI) a plus.
